Output 3d81e6c475002c7f2f8a52625ff827a470d1776c958b88489190a31bd6fa8680:0

value
408112564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625c351dda63657422cedfca92b44322e3ce6f18 OP_EQUAL
address
3Af6c2nfZgY9GKoDg1fQooLN4wqndqBkyF
transaction
3d81e6c475002c7f2f8a52625ff827a470d1776c958b88489190a31bd6fa8680
confirmations
332564
spent
true